What is the Fastest Whale? Unveiling the Ocean’s Speedster

The sei whale (Balaenoptera borealis) is generally recognized as the fastest whale, capable of reaching burst speeds of up to 30-50 miles per hour in short sprints. Determining the exact speed is challenging, but observations and studies consistently place the sei whale at the top of the marine speed chart.

The Sei Whale: A Streamlined Speed Demon

The sei whale, a baleen whale belonging to the Rorqual family, is uniquely adapted for high-speed swimming. Understanding its anatomy, habitat, and hunting strategies provides crucial insights into its impressive velocity. Its scientific name, Balaenoptera borealis, hints at its preference for colder, northern waters, although its migration patterns take it across vast stretches of the ocean.

Anatomy and Adaptations for Speed

Several key anatomical features contribute to the sei whale’s remarkable speed:

  • Streamlined Body: Like other Rorquals, the sei whale possesses a long, slender body with a sleek, torpedo-like shape that minimizes drag in the water.
  • Powerful Tail Flukes: The large, broad tail flukes provide immense propulsion, allowing the whale to generate bursts of speed.
  • Flexible Body: The sei whale’s flexible body allows it to undulate efficiently, converting muscle power into forward motion.
  • Relatively Small Size: Compared to other baleen whales like the blue whale or humpback whale, the sei whale is smaller, making it more agile and maneuverable. This smaller size-to-power ratio is a significant factor in its speed advantage.
  • Specific Blubber Composition: The blubber composition and thickness further enhance streamlining and provide insulation without hindering movement.

Habitat and Hunting Strategies

Sei whales are found in all oceans, preferring temperate and subpolar waters. Their migratory patterns often follow the seasonal availability of their primary food source: copepods, krill, and small schooling fish. Their feeding strategy directly impacts their need for speed. They are skimming feeders that swim with their mouths open, filtering out plankton and small fish.

Their hunting strategies often involve short, high-speed bursts to overtake schools of fish or krill swarms. This demands the ability to quickly accelerate and maintain a high speed for a short duration.

Challenges in Measuring Whale Speed

Precisely measuring the speed of a whale in its natural environment poses significant challenges. Factors that complicate accurate measurements include:

  • Short Duration Bursts: Whales typically only reach their maximum speeds for brief periods, making observation and measurement difficult.
  • Environmental Conditions: Ocean currents, wind, and wave action can affect a whale’s speed and direction.
  • Limited Technology: Accurately tracking a whale’s movements over long distances requires sophisticated technology, which may not always be readily available.
  • Ethical Considerations: Approaching whales too closely to measure their speed can disrupt their behavior and potentially harm them.

Other Fast Whale Contenders

While the sei whale is widely regarded as the fastest, other whale species are also known for their impressive swimming speeds:

  • Fin Whale: Another Rorqual whale, the fin whale, is known for its speed and agility. It can reach speeds of up to 30 miles per hour.
  • Minke Whale: Minke whales are smaller and more agile than sei whales, but they are still capable of reaching speeds of up to 20 miles per hour.
  • Killer Whale (Orca): While technically a toothed whale (a dolphin), orcas are apex predators known for their intelligence and hunting prowess, and can reach speeds of up to 34 mph in short bursts when hunting.
Whale Species Estimated Maximum Speed (mph) Primary Diet Habitat
:—————- :—————————– :———————————- :—————————-
Sei Whale 30-50 Copepods, Krill, Small Fish Temperate & Subpolar Oceans
Fin Whale 30 Krill, Small Fish, Squid All Oceans
Minke Whale 20 Krill, Small Fish All Oceans
Killer Whale 34 Fish, Seals, Other Marine Mammals All Oceans

Conservation Status of Sei Whales

Sadly, the sei whale is an endangered species. Their populations were severely depleted by commercial whaling in the 20th century. While whaling is now largely banned, sei whales still face numerous threats, including:

  • Entanglement in Fishing Gear: Whales can become entangled in fishing nets and lines, leading to injury or death.
  • Ship Strikes: Collisions with ships can cause serious injury or death.
  • Pollution: Pollution can contaminate the whales’ food supply and harm their health.
  • Climate Change: Climate change is altering ocean temperatures and currents, which can affect the distribution and abundance of their prey.

Frequently Asked Questions (FAQs)

What is the absolute fastest recorded speed of a sei whale?

While precise measurements are difficult to obtain, the highest estimated speeds for sei whales are in the range of 30-50 miles per hour. These speeds are usually achieved during short bursts, such as when hunting prey.

Are there any other animals in the ocean faster than a sei whale?

Yes, several other marine animals are known to be faster than sei whales. Certain species of billfish, such as the sailfish and marlin, can reach speeds of up to 70 miles per hour. However, these are fish, not whales. Among whales, the Sei whale remains the top contender.

How do scientists measure the speed of whales?

Scientists employ a variety of techniques, including GPS tracking tags, sonar, and visual observation. Analyzing the data collected from these methods allows researchers to estimate the whales’ speed and movement patterns.

Do sei whales use their speed for anything besides hunting?

While speed is primarily used for hunting, sei whales may also use it to escape predators (though they have few natural predators besides killer whales) and for long-distance migration.

Does the size of a whale affect its speed?

Generally, smaller whales tend to be more agile and faster than larger whales. However, larger whales can generate more power due to their greater muscle mass. The sei whale’s relatively smaller size within the Rorqual family contributes to its speed advantage.
